June 14, 2025 Ona Beach & Brian Booth State Park
Liz-Laver-Holencik led 23 birders through Ona Beach State Park. The open area has many swallow boxes and we were able to observe lots of activity. The area was filled with bird song and Liz was able to identify the birds with its song. We traveled across the road to Brian Booth State Park where everyone enjoyed the beautiful surroundings.
